Catholic made up a huge gap compared to their last game against Collegiate, but they still couldn't quite topple them. The Crusaders put the hurt on the Cougars with a sharp 23-17 victory on Tuesday. The Crusaders' hitters stepped up their game for this one, as that was the most runs they've scored all season.
The win made it two in a row for Catholic and bumps their season record up to 2-2. Those victories came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 18.5 runs over those games. As for Collegiate, they are on a five-game losing streak (dating back to last season) that has dropped them down to 0-4.
Catholic wasted no time getting back out on the field and has already played their next contest, a 15-4 loss against Christchurch School on the 27th. As for Collegiate, they also did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next match, a 21-0 defeat against Miller School of Albemarle on the 28th.
